Majid Alshammari is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Information Systems and Signal Processing. According to data from OpenAlex, Majid Alshammari has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 258 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Computer Networks and Communications, 12 papers in Information Systems and 6 papers in Signal Processing. Recurrent topics in Majid Alshammari's work include Network Security and Intrusion Detection (7 papers), Advanced Malware Detection Techniques (6 papers) and Security in Wireless Sensor Networks (4 papers). Majid Alshammari is often cited by papers focused on Network Security and Intrusion Detection (7 papers), Advanced Malware Detection Techniques (6 papers) and Security in Wireless Sensor Networks (4 papers). Majid Alshammari collaborates with scholars based in Saudi Arabia, United States and Kazakhstan. Majid Alshammari's co-authors include Abdullah Alharbi, Hashem Alyami, Khaled Elleithy, Hafiz Tayyab Rauf, Amerah Alabrah, Talha Meraj, Abdul Razaque, Rashid A. Saeed, Muder Almiani and Hesham Alhumyani and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Access, Sensors and Applied Sciences.
